Decoding Purines: The Building Blocks of DNA

Purines are essential compounds in all living cells, crucial for DNA and RNA structure. They consist of a nitrogen-containing two-ring structure and include adenine and guanine. Purines are vital for nucleic acid synthesis, energy metabolism (ATP), and cell signaling (cAMP). An imbalance can lead to health issues like gout and kidney stones, so a balanced diet with low-purine foods is advisable to prevent complications.

The Science Behind Dipeptides: Unlocking Nature’s Building Blocks

Dipeptides are formed by the condensation of two amino acids linked by a peptide bond, releasing a water molecule. They are fundamental in protein synthesis and biochemical processes. Acting independently, dipeptides are crucial in metabolism, nutrition, and medicine, influencing enzyme activity and signaling pathways. Studying them offers insights into protein structures and functions.

Phosphocreatine: The Hero of Athletic Performance Enhancement

Phosphocreatine, or creatine phosphate, is crucial for muscle energy systems, acting as a quick reserve of high-energy phosphates. It helps regenerate ATP, the cell’s energy currency, during intense physical activity by donating a phosphate group to ADP. This process supports muscle work, providing short-term energy until other pathways can sustain activity. Phosphocreatine stores deplete during exercise but replenish during rest, and supplementation can enhance performance, strength, and recovery, making it popular among athletes.

Phospholipids: The Unsung Heroes of Cell Membranes

Phospholipids are essential lipid molecules crucial for the structural integrity of cell membranes. Each consists of a glycerol backbone linked to two fatty acid tails and a phosphate group, giving rise to hydrophilic “heads” and hydrophobic “tails.” This structure enables the formation of bilayers, contributing to membrane fluidity, cell signaling, and selective permeability, vital for maintaining homeostasis.

Peptide Side Effects: What to Know Before Starting Treatment

Peptides, known for their beneficial properties in medical and cosmetic applications, can sometimes lead to side effects based on usage and individual factors. While often safe, peptides in skincare might cause mild irritation. When taken as supplements or injectables, they could induce digestive issues, water retention, or blood sugar changes. Hormone-mimicking peptides may disrupt hormonal balance if improperly used. Consulting healthcare professionals before starting a peptide regimen is crucial to ensure the correct usage and sourcing, as the purity and composition significantly affect their impact and safety.

Anabolism: The Building Blocks of Body Growth and Repair

Anabolism is a crucial aspect of metabolism, characterized by the constructive phase where energy is used to synthesize complex molecules from simpler ones. This involves building cellular components like proteins and carbohydrates, essential for cell growth and repair. Fueled by energy from catabolic processes, anabolism requires ATP and involves enzyme-catalyzed reactions. Hormones like insulin play vital roles, stimulating pathways for tissue regeneration and energy storage.

Anabolize

Anabolize refers to the phase of metabolism in which simple substances are synthesized into complex materials of living tissue. This process, fueled by adenosine triphosphate (ATP), is crucial for growth, repair, and cell maintenance. Hormones like insulin, growth hormone, and testosterone drive these processes, facilitating protein synthesis for muscle growth, bone mineralization, and lipid production. Emphasizing a balanced diet, structured routines, and adequate rest maximizes anabolic potential.
